Output 52a678a51dfcab65037c160eddf4131e50b36870f4370769e8b8f3f41d7941e9:0

value
53059755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229faf8429935603221bd0b73ad5166988a097c4 OP_EQUAL
address
MB4EW6wE7jbF4BNYhdYYChzxqwAby9MZbY
transaction
52a678a51dfcab65037c160eddf4131e50b36870f4370769e8b8f3f41d7941e9
spent
true